All Natural Ways to Control Slugs
Tom hates always giving up his beer to battle slugs …. Just kidding!!
… Here are eight ways to stop those little critters in their tracks.
All Natural Ways To Control Slugs from The Funtime Guide.
1. Beer:
Those pesky slugs hold their alcohol like a 12-year-old girl. Ideal Bite has
some clever thoughts on using beer traps for natural slug control… including
the “one for you, one for me” approach. Ha!
2. Egg Shells:
Mother Earth News recommends crushing up egg shells and sprinkling them around
your plants. Obviously the egg shells will also benefit the soil as they
decompose… so they provide double the benefit.3. Diatomaceous Earth: Diatoma what? Diatomaceous earth is basically the natural fossilized remains of diatoms, a type of hard-shelled algae. Just as with egg shells, soft-bodied pests (like slugs and snails) will not crawl over it… for the same reason humans won’t walk on broken glass.
4. Sandpaper: Just as with egg shells and diatomaceous earth, rough sandpaper is too painful for the slugs to cross.
5. Citrus Rinds: Planet Green recommends using upside down halves of grapefruit rinds as a slug traps. Set them out at night and you’ll have slugs up inside them in the morning. Personally i’m not a big fan of the trapping techniques as I don’t really want to have to see and dispose of the slugs… they disgust me. Blah!
6. Seaweed: EarthEasy.com says, “If you have access to seaweed, it’s well worth the effort to gather. Seaweed is not only a good soil amendment for the garden, it’s a natural repellent for slugs. Mulch with seaweed around the base of plants or perimeter of bed. Pile it on 3″ to 4″ thick – when it dries it will shrink to just an inch or so deep. Seaweed is salty and slugs avoid salt. Push the seaweed away from plant stems so it’s not in direct contact. During hot weather, seaweed will dry and become very rough which also deters the slugs.” Be sure to check out EarthEasy’s list of natural slug repellents. You’ll find some of the same and some different methods than what we’re talking about here.
7. Organic Baits: The Weekend Gardner web magazine recommends using either Sluggo or Escar-Go. How do they work? Iron phosphate. Weekend Gardner says, “Iron phosphate is an organic compound that is found naturally in the soil, and if the bait is not consumed by a slug or snail, the material breaks down into fertilizer for your soil. Iron phosphate is not volatile, and does not readily dissolve in water, which minimizes its dispersal beyond where it is applied.”
8.Companion Planting: I didn’t know about companion planting when we planted our garden, but I’ll definitely be using it next year. Basically, certain plants planted near each other benefit each other and may also deter certain pests. Plants that deter slugs are: wormwood, rue, fennel, anise, and rosemary.

Garden in a Bale of Straw
Limited space? No soil? Toxic or rocky ground? Spare corner? Edge of drive way or yard? Here's bales of advice for you on the straw bale gardening.
Straw bale, or hay bale gardening is not to be confused with using loose straw in your garden for mulch or compost. What we're talking about here is the whole bale, as it stands, tied with twine and used for planting plants on the top.
The bale is the garden. Put it on your balcony or path if you want to. Use one or umpteen bales of straw or hay as you need and in any pattern. Because the straw bale garden is raised, it's easy to work with, so make sure you allow for handy access.
Which straw to use for straw bale gardening? The best straw bales, for a garden are wheat, oats, rye or barley straw. These consist of stalks left from harvesting grain, they have been through a combine harvester and had the seeds threshed from them, leaving none or very few left.
Hay bales for gardening are less popular as they have the whole stalk and seed heads with many seeds. They also often have other weeds and grass seeds to cause trouble. Use what you can get locally--it may even be lucerne, pea straw, vetch or alfalfa bales. Corn and linseed (flax) bales are not so good as they are very coarse, and linseed straw take a long time to decompose due to the oil residue left on the stalks.
It's simple to pull out the odd wayward grain seeds with straw bale gardening, but hay hales have a tendency to grow the likes of a small lawn! Thus you may need to occasionally give them a haircut rather than try to pull the tenacious new sprouts out. Hay bale gardening has one up on straw in that it is a nice warm and rich environment with enough nitrogen to continually supply growing plants. Straw is mostly carbon and so nitrogen must be added for plant growth (see information below).
Where to buy straw bales for garden? Most garden supply centers and nurseries sell straw bales. Farmers are you next bet if you live in the country. Also try animal breeding places and stables as they often buy straw bales in bulk for bedding and may sell you one.
How much do straw bales cost? Straw bales costs vary from country to country, but your cheapest option is usually going to a farm where you could be lucky at $1.00 per bale. Otherwise prices range from $2-$3 per bale. Still good value for an instant little garden!
Arranging your straw bale garden. Put each bale in the exact place, because it's hard to even nudge these monsters once you've got your little straw bale garden going.
Just like a normal vegetable garden your straw bale plants need sun, 4-8 hours if possible, depending on your choice of plants. Leafy greens and some herbs need slightly less sun than vines and tomatoes for example.
A very popular idea for hay bales and straw bales is to make a raised garden bed with the bales as the edge. This limits excessive evaporation from both the garden in the middle and one side of the bale.
If you are starting a no-dig garden and don't have enough filling to begin with before your compost, kitchen scraps, grass clippings, leaves, mulch or whatever you have, are not ready, then a cheap way for the first year is to buy bales and with a little bit of compost on the top, and a few other ingredients mentioned here, you can get your garden going the first year.
Deter those darn digging moles, gophers, rats or whatever thieves populate your area, by first laying down galvanized wire bird netting before laying your bales down. Lay the bales lengthwise to make planting easy by just parting the pads of straw.
There are two options on which side to lay straw bales:
1. Make sure the string is running around each bale and not on the side touching the ground in case its degradable twine such as sisal. The straw is now vertical, cut ends up. This means when you water , much of it will go straight through the bale and wash away.
2. Laying your bale or bales with the twine touching the ground (as long as it's plastic or wire twine of course), means that the straw stalks are horizontal and water will more likely soak in and not flow through the bale and be wasted.
This method of laying down your straw bale lends itself to using a soaker hose better than the vertical way. If using a soaker hose, which are marvelous by the way, lay it under the twine to stay in place. The steady slow drips of water will find it hard to escape through channels, unlike the vertical method whereby the water channels downwards.
Starting your straw bale garden. If you start with aged bales of about 6 months or more, they may already have been through their initial weathering and starting to decompose slightly inside. If they have been wet at all they almost certainly would have lost their cool and done their cooking.
If not and they are still new or in pristine condition, they need to do a bit of stewing before it's safe to plant in them. Thoroughly soak with water and add more water so they don't dry out at all for the next 5 days whilst the temperature rises and cooks them inside. Slowly they will cool over the next 1-2 weeks and then be ready for planting.
You can plant when the bales are still warm( which promotes root growth). The bales won't be composting much inside yet, that takes months, but you don't want that initial hot cooking of your plants.
Some sneaky people speed up the process of producing microbes and rot by following a 10-day pre-treatment regime of water and ammonium nitrate on the top of each bale. But, hey, organic gardeners are a patient lot aren't we, so let's follow nature. Just so you know, the chemical ammonium nitrate (AN) acts as a catalyst. It is high in nitrogen and encourages and feeds microbes which rot the straw so plants can grow.
More natural ways that help speed up that all important burn out, are to spread on a high nitrogen organic fertilizer just before you start your watering process and watered in each day as detailed above. Remember though that this fertilizing along with the initial soaking will mean that the bales will continue to cook longer and you will have to wait before planting. It ultimately provides a better base and growing conditions and saves you having to be so worried about getting nutrients to your plants as they start growing.
Some materials that can be used are:
* A 3cm (1') layer of fresh chicken manure - double that if aged chicken manure, or
* Other suitable manures such as turkey or rabbit - 5mc (2") layer, or
* A covering layer of 2/3 bone meal to 1/3 blood mean, or
* A very thick layer of milder stuff such as spent coffee grounds.
Also to balance the growing medium, add potassium by sprinkling on a handful of sulphate or potash.
Watering a straw bale garden. Keep watered. That's going to be your biggest task -- twice a day if necessary. Straw bale gardening uses more water than a normal garden, so set up a system now. It may be that hauling out the teapot on each day is enough in your area, or you may need to keep the hose handy. A soaker hose system set in place is perfect.
Anything you can put on the exposed sides of your straw bales will help conserve water and stop them drying out in the sun. Low bushes or herbs, planks or bricks and so on will work. If you have some plastic and don't mind the unnatural look in your garden, then put that around the sides. Keep the twine there to hold it all in place for a long as possible.
What plants to plant? Annuals of vegetables, herbs or flowers will love your straw bale. Remember your bales will be history in 1-2 years. Young plants can go straight in. Pull apart or use a trowel and depending on the state of the straw, put a handful of compost soil in too, then let the straw go back into place.
Seeds can be planted on top if you put a good 5cm (2") layer of compost soil there first. Top heavies like corn and okra are not so good unless you grow dwarf varieties. With straw bale gardening it's hard to put solid stakes in so big tomato plants are out, although they will happily dangle over the edge.
Each bale should hold:
* Up to half a dozen cucumbers, trailing down, or
* Squash, zucchini, melons -- maybe 3 plants, or
* A couple of tomato plants per bale with one or two herbs and leafy veggies in between, or
* Four pepper plants will fit, or
* 12-15 bean or pea plants, or
* A mix of the above or any other plants you like.

Since there's no limit and why not poke in around the side some flower annuals for color and companionship if you like.
Once a week or more often when your plants are in full growth water in a liquid organic feed, such as compost tea or fish emulsion. Add some worms on top if you want to use your bales only one season. If you are using hay bales instead of straw bales, the liquid feed can be spaced much further apart because hay bales have more nutrient dense environment.
You'll get one good season out of a hay bale garden, and usually two with a straw bale, albeit with a bit of sag. It make s for great compost or mulch when finished with.

Want to Save Money on Groceries? Grow These Six Veggies at Home
If you are growing vegetables in the hope of saving money, here are some suggestions for crops which have delivered real cost savings for us…
By Greg Seaman, Eartheasy
Posted Jan 19, 2011
There are many benefits to growing your own vegetables, but saving money is not necessarily one of them. Some vegetables are simply cheaper to buy at the grocery store, and no amount of gardening savvy will result in a cost-saving benefit.
Over the years we have experimented with many vegetable crops, and while saving money is not the prime reason we grow vegetables, it is a consideration in our choice of what to plant. Although we are fortunate to have plenty of ground space for gardening, the work required to keep the beds fertile and weed free discourages us from planting some crops which are ‘dirt cheap’ when bought in season.
If you are growing vegetables in the hope of saving money, or want to make the most from limited garden space, here are some suggestions for crops which have delivered real cost savings for us. When planning your garden and buying seeds, however, be sure to choose varieties which do well in your growing region. Even within regions there are ‘micro-climates’ which affect growing conditions, so check locally for advice about recommended varieties for your locale.
1. Lettuce
You may have noticed the price of lettuce has risen considerably in the past two years. At a nearby market today, red leaf lettuce cost $1.79 for a small bunch. (And the Spring Mix, a ready to serve assorted lettuce mix sold in a plastic box, cost $4 per 300 grams!) If you grow your own lettuce, from a $2 package of seed you’ll recoup the cost within a few weeks and enjoy your own fresh lettuce for months. Be sure to plant only a small amount of seed, or the unharvested mature lettuce will bolt. Save the remaining seed for replanting every two to three weeks throughout the growing season. This will ensure a steady supply of fresh greens for the table.
In our garden we grow two varieties of leafy lettuce, Magenta (red leaf) and Concept (green leaf). We do not grow head-forming lettuce, like Iceberg, because it takes longer to mature and when ready it gives us too much lettuce at one time. We find that head lettuce also harbors more slugs. The leafy varieties are easy to harvest by picking the outer leaves, and this lets the plant continue to grow and produce.
2. Bell peppers
Green bell peppers cost about $1.50 each at our supermarket, and yellow and red peppers are even more expensive due to their extended ripening times. Pepper starter plants, however, cost about $1 each at our local nursery. This past year we planted ten pepper plants and each plant produced at least six peppers. We let most of our pepper crop mature until they turn red because they taste sweeter than green peppers. My rough estimate is that our $10 investment yielded about $100 in peppers. We don’t use commercial fertilizers, but did add about $5 in peat moss and $5 in amendments like rock phosphate and lime.
Easy to grow, peppers are commonly started early in small pots and transplanted when it’s warm enough outside. Pick off any small peppers that may form on transplants or the plant growth will be stunted. Pick the green peppers as soon as they reach size; this will stimulate new fruiting and increase the yield per plant. You can leave some plants unpicked if you want the peppers to sweeten and turn yellow or red; however, these plants will produce fewer peppers.
3. Garlic
The price of a garlic bulb ranges from $1 to $7 a pound. Our homegrown garlic, grown from cloves saved from the previous crop, cost less than $.50 a pound to grow ourselves.
Garlic is one of the easier crops to grow, but we lost our first couple of crops due to over-watering when the plants were mature. Garlic is often grown over winter which makes good use of garden space. Weeding is important as garlic does not like competition. Harvesting on time and curing properly are important for producing bulbs with good keeping qualities.
In northern regions, garlic does best when planted in the fall. The timing of fall planting should be such that the roots have a chance to develop and the tops do not break the surface before winter, about three weeks before the ground freezes. In some regions spring planting is traditional. We have planted garlic in the spring with mixed results.
4. Winter Squash
At our local supermarket today, winter squash varieties cost between $1.29 and $1.99 a pound. (This is mid-winter pricing, which is more costly.) Our four homegrown squash plants yielded about 40 squash, weighing 4 lbs each on average, which adds up to about 160 pounds. This is worth between $200 – $300. We were given the starter plants, and spent about $15 in soil amendments. Squash starter plants are available for about $2 each.
Winter squash are a favorite among gardeners because they’re easy to grow, don’t require weeding once established, and most importantly, they keep through the winter to provide a valued vegetable for eating all winter and spring. The squash bed does need to be richly prepared before planting, and the runners need a lot of room to spread. If you have space to spare, then growing winter squash makes sense, and saves dollars. (In the photo below, all the squash leaves are from a single plant, which yielded 14 large squash.)
5. Tomatoes
It’s difficult to come up with an accurate figure for the cost of tomatoes because the cost varies so much by season and region. But assigning a range of $2 to $4 a pound is reasonable for this comparison. Last summer we planted four plants of a large variety (Big Beef), two cherry tomato plants (Sun Gold), and two paste tomato plants. Each of the larger plants produced at least 15 large beefsteak tomatoes weighing 1 pound or more. I would estimate that we grew 80 pounds of tomatoes (worth $160 – $320) for a cost of about $40. (Starter tomatoes are about $4 each, and we added about $15 in amendments.
We grew all eight plants in the same 6’ x 12’ plot. The cherry tomatoes provide an early harvest, the large tomatoes are used for summer and fall eating, and the meaty paste tomatoes are good for freezing and canning. Paste tomatoes also make excellent fresh or cooked salsa and sauces. Having a ready supply of tomatoes for cooking during the winter months adds value, since the price of tomatoes goes up in winter.
6. Broccoli
Broccoli costs about $1.50 a pound, which is pretty cheap. Central head weights range from 0.3 to 1 pound, so you get a fair amount of broccoli for the price. After cutting off the central head, many side shoots will grow below, and will equal two to three times the original crown. Our ten broccoli plants produced about 2 pounds each, so we grew about $30 worth of broccoli for a cost of about $10 in soil amendments. The amount of money saved is not enough to get excited about, but the convenience of having fresh-picked broccoli available for 6 – 8 months is a real bonus.
Broccoli is a cool-season crop, and can be grown both as a spring and a fall crop. Broccoli is a heavy feeder and requires soil rich with organic matter. We plant our beds in green manure during the off-season which is a low-cost way of fertilizing the soil. Before planting, compost and peat are worked into the soil, and lime and rock phosphate if needed.
Broccoli is highly nutritious and has been deemed an anti-cancerous food by the American Cancer Society. This vegetable is a good source of Vitamin A, calcium, and riboflavin (or vitamin B2). Even in our northern region, we are usually able to keep a few broccoli plants over winter and harvest the side shoots which continue to sprout. We’ve even had a few hardy plants continue to produce while covered in snow.
The figures used in this article are approximate. We did not weigh every tomato or leaf of lettuce. And the list is by no means exclusive. There are other crops which are cost-effective to grow, and some of the crops listed on this page may be difficult to grow in some regions. The examples listed here show what’s worked best for us, and serve to illustrate that growing your own vegetables can bring down your family’s yearly produce expenses.
As any gardener knows, growing vegetables is more than about saving money. Growing your own vegetables is healthier for the family because the produce is fresh and (hopefully) grown without chemicals. It is better for the environment by reducing the cost of food transport, there are educational benefits for the children, and oh yes, the vegetables will taste so much better!

How to Trellis Tomatoes
I can never get those tomato cages to work for me. I tried the Topsy-Turvy one year and dumped the tomatoes all over the ground ... maybe I will try this method for staking up my tomatoes this year.
My tomatoes are only a few inches tall and still indoors, but this is the ideal time to start thinking about how to trellis them. For years I fiddled with the dinky round tomato cages sold everywhere that just fall over when faced with a large indeterminate tomato. One year I even tried tying two cages on top of one another and it still fell over.
Market Farmers don't use wussy home-gardening-type trellises. They bring out the T-Posts and plastic baling twine orstring. (This is one time you can't use natural twines like jute or cotton...they are too stretchy.) The most common technique is called the Florida Weave.
Basically, you place tall (7 foot min) T-posts at each end of your tomato row. Every two or three plants, add a stake (or another T post). You will then “weave” the twine around the T-posts and tomatoes in a basic figure-eight shape. T-posts are super sturdy and stay put once you pound them into the ground. Ideally, you can string the T-posts before the tomatoes are tall or perhaps even planted. As the tomatoes grow you can tuck the growing edge into one of the rows of string. The beauty of the Florida Weave is that even if you are late getting your trellising in place, you can still do a pretty good job pulling up the overgrown tomatoes.

Green Onion Benefits and Growing Tips
I just bought my Walla Walla sweet onion sets, some shallots (which were $6.99/lb at Market of Choice so I decided that I would grow my own), and green onions. I am all ready to plant them, but I thought I better figure out HOW!!
I use a lot of shallots or green onions in my cooking for a little flavor and color, but I never realized they were so good for me. Here is a little poster that explains some of their benefits.
Green Onions have an almost unlimited amount of uses and are very easy to grow. Green onions can be grown from seed or as sets. I love green onions in soups, salads, on top of a nice steak, used as a baked potato topping, and many other ways. Green onions are also referred to as bunching onions, and have a milder onion taste than storage onions.
They are actually immature onions that are harvested before the bulb matures. The green onion features a dark green stem (also called scallions) and a white bulb with roots. Both parts of the onion are edible. There are several different cultivars of green onion including, 'Evergreen Long White', 'Parade', and 'Red Baron' to name a few.
Plant onion seed as soon as the soil can be worked in the spring. Onion seeds germinate in a wide range of soil temperature, between 65° F and 86° F.
Sow and cover seed with ½” of soil and keep moist. Seeds can be started indoors 6-8 weeks prior to planting. They can be set in the garden about 1-1½” apart. To plant onions sets, simply press sets into the soil about 2″ apart.
Onions benefit from full sun, a soil pH of 6.0-7.5 and a well drained soil with plenty of premium compost or well rotted manure added. Feed with a complete balanced fertilizer during the growing season.
Green onions generally need about one inch of water per week. If green onions are grown in rows, or raised beds, soaker hoses can be used for irrigation. It’s also a good idea to mulch around the plants to conserve soil moisture and suppress weeds.
The soil should be moist, but not soggy. A great way to check to see if your green onions need watering is the finger test. Simply stick your finger in the soil down to the second knuckle near the green onion plan. If the soil feels moist there is no need to water. If the soil feels dry go ahead and water well. Repeat the finger test once a week depending on how much rainfall you have received.
Green onions can also be grown successfully in containers. Soil in containers can dry out quickly during very hot summer temperatures, so you may need to water them up to three times per day if rainfall amounts are inadequate.
Allowing the soil to dry out too much can cause the onion bulbs to also dry out.
Also, make sure the container has good drainage holes. You want to avoid soggy soil in containers, too. Getting the watering amounts down right may take some practice, but it’s not too difficult.
To use as dried bulbs, wait until the green tops have withered and browned, then stop watering. Most green onions are ready to harvest between 70-90 days.
When you are slicing or preparing a green onion, leave about 1″ above the root. This section can be re-planted into the soil. Place the root section about 1″ deep in the soil, root side down, and lightly cover the top with soil.
The root section will then re-sprout the green tops within a couple weeks. This process can be repeated several times with the same root section. A great way to “recycle” your green onions!

Raised Bed Gardens - Tips & Tricks
Here is a great article by Doreen G. Howard. Tom made our raised beds from boards we had left over from construction, so we saved on the cost of the boards, but building these raised bed gardens would be worth any price because we have so much clay in our soil that we could be making pots! By putting "good" soil on top of the clay gives our plants a fighting chance for survival.
Growing your own produce can save you some money too. I calculated that just by growing our own lettuce we are saving over $300/year.
Doreen's article:
Every time I open a plant catalog or see a television commercial for sale priced $99 raised bed gardening kits, I cringe! I've never spent more than $8 to build a four-by-four-foot bed or $35 to build a 20-foot-long one.
My husband builds mine. He buys two 1 by 8-inch cedar boards, which don't rot with age. They come in 8-foot lengths, which is perfect for 4 by 4-foot beds. Cut each plank in half, so that it is 4-feet long. Or have the store make the cuts. Many places will do it for free.
Husband also buys a 3-foot length of a 1 by 1-inch pine stake; he cuts it into four pieces and uses them to nail the cedar boards to at corners for bracing. That's all! Each box costs less than $10 to make.

Grouping together several raised beds makes a substantial vegetable garden that is easy to maintain, with no weeding and crops that mature fast
I place the boxes on cleared ground. Turf should be cut and rolled up, or vegetation killer can be used. Strong white vinegar applied to grass in sunlight will kill the turf in hours. After I situate the boxes (four or five grouped together makes a good sized garden), I put down three layers of newspaper to suppress errant weed or grass seeds that might sprout. Paper degrades fully within weeks and feeds the soil.
Another fast, cheap method of building raised beds is to use concrete construction blocks. They have a big bonus. Their holes can be filled with soil mix and planted with herbs or strawberries.
The extra gathered heat from concrete is perfect for Mediterranean-type herbs such as rosemary and lavender. Strawberry plants grow huge and fruit fast in the holes. Each block is 16 inches long by 8 inches high and costs about $1.30 each at big box stores. Beds of 13 feet or longer by 4 feet wide are cheaper to build using blocks than with cedar boards.
.jpg)
Cement construction blocks average about $1.30 apiece across the country.
You will be planting seeds and transplants close, because the beds are smaller and the soil is richer. But, plants grown close together in raised beds mature faster, because they compete for nutrients and sunlight. Each plant senses the distance of others and adjusts its metabolism to compete. Several university studies have proven this competition syndrome by identifying how plants perceive others nearby using the green light spectrum.

This 4-by-4-foot bed is crowded with productive peppers, cucumbers, a tomato plant and insect-repelling flowers that are edible.
Raised Bed Soil MixThe more organic matter there is in soil, the better. Soil microbes are fed, oxygen and water
readily reach roots and plants thrive. Here’s the recipe I’ve developed in the last decade that
works best for my garden.
For one 4-by-4-foot raised bed. (Multiply amounts to fill larger beds.)
2 bags (2-cubic-feet each) top soil
1 pail (3-cubic-feet) peat moss
1 bag (2 to 3-cubic feet) compost or composted cow manure
2-inch layer of shredded leaves or grass clipping.
If you use grass, make sure the clippings are not from a lawn that has been sprayed with herbicides or been fertilized with a food that contains granular herbicides to kill weeds. Both persist and will kill plants beds up to three years after the initial application.
Mix all materials with a hoe or cultivator and water well. Be sure to mulch well with organic Matter such as more leaves or clippings or straw.

How to Build a Living Wall (Vertical Garden)
This great idea came from The Tumbleweed Traveller. I think we might try this, but in a smaller version. This would make a GREAT edible privacy fence in a small yard!!! Diagrams and Building Instructions are included in this article. Enjoy!
Liz, myself and the newly planted vertical garden.
A few years ago now, on a trip to Paris, quite by chance I came a cross a vertical garden or living wall created and installed by the French gardener and designer ‘Patrick Blanc‘. The plants are rooted into a thick hydroponics membrane through which a nutrient enriched solution trickles, pumped up from a reservoir at the base of the wall which keeps the plants fed and watered.
The vertical garden on the wall of the Musée des Arts Premiers Quai Branly in Paris.
I had often spoke with a friend of mine ‘Will Giles’ about how we could create a DIY version, looking at all the possible ways of supporting it, what to use as the membrane, how to hold it up, what to use as the reservoir and how to feed the plants among many other things. After a while we came up with a much simpler solution, as the best ideas always are. Do away with the expensive and intricate hydroponics and build a structure that is essentially a series of hammocks, a bit like a multi story window box. It may take a little bit of daily care to keep the plants watered and looking good but is much easier and cheaper to build.
It was while I was working at Urban Jungle hardy and exotic plants nursery that I had the opportunity to put the idea to the test. I had a rough idea of how the structure might work but no set figures to work from. I could see ‘Liz’ my boss and one of the owners of Urban Jungle looked a little apprehensive as I was attaching 12ft high pieces of timber to the edge of one of the pergolas in the middle of the nursery. Once the wall had taken shape and looked as if the monstrosity was going to work, apprehension quickly turned to plants. Once the wall was up and the pockets filled with compost we set about rounding up plants from the nursery and setting the out on the floor in front of the wall for planting, and then planted well into the night. The wall turned out to look not too bad and after a week or so, when the leaves had turned themselves up to the light, it looked pretty damn good. Many visitors to the nursery asked how it was built so here, at last, are the designs for the vertical garden. Sorry about the wait.
Planting the wall by headlight.
The wall is now coming up to its second season and has endured one of the coldest winters for years, where I’m shore the entire thing would have been frozen solid for several days if not weeks at a time. I’m no longer at Urban Jungle but have heard from Liz that some of the plants are now on the move and in a short time she will be able to see what had pulled through and what needs tweaking. Some plants were not hardy so there will inevitably be some gaps to plug. Liz is going to put up a post on Jungle Drums, the Urban Jungle blog, in the coming weeks on the progress of the wall, what has worked, what hasn’t and the new plants that will fill the gaps. As soon as it’s up I’ll post a link.
HOW TO BUILD YOUR OWN LIVING WALL OR VERTICAL GARDEN
1) CHOOSE A LOCATION- Once the wall is planted and watered it will be very heavy so a suitable structure is needed to support the wall. If the base of the wall is resting on the ground and this is not a solid surface, place slabs under each of the uprights to spread the weight and prevent it from sinking into the ground. If the wall is not resting on the ground make shore the brackets used to hold the living wall to the supporting structure are strong to take the weight of the wall when saturated. If the supporting is a house or shed wall the structure should be mounted away from the supporting wall to leave a cavity and avoid causing damp problems.
2) ORIENTATION- The place we chose for the wall at Urban Jungle by chance faces east. This in my opinion is the best direction for it to face as it gets direct light up until noon in the coolest half of the day. If the wall was south or west facing more particular attention would have to be paid to watering and plants would have to be selected to tolerate direct light. Regarding watering, it is important to be diligent as anyone who has let a hanging basket dry out knows it takes a while to re-wet, and you cant dunk the wall in a bucket. North facing walls would require less attention but the constant shade will limit the choice of plants.
3) CONSTRUCTION- The wall at Urban Jungle was 12ft high, 7ft wide and build against a large pergola for support. I used three uprights made from 12ft lengths of 2x4 tantalised timber. The two uprights on the edge of the wall were attached to the uprights of the pergola with brackets and the middle upright stabilised by a post in the ground and two cross members. Each of the uprights was rested on a paving slabs to help spread the weight. The horizontal spars that support the planting hammocks were made from tile baton. Each spar was screwed in place with a little wood glue for extra support. The spars were placed 10cm apart. This made the pockets closemouthed together so that when planted not too much gaps are left but there is enough room to squeeze the root balls in.
How to build the timber structure that supports the wall.
4) POCKETS- Because the wall had three uprights there had to be two series of pockets as they cant cross the uprights. The pockets were made from heavy duty landscape fabric which needs to be about two and a half times longer than the height of the wall and about 20cm wider than the width between the uprights. Start by folding about 10cm in each side so the fold is facing the front and attach to the back of the top spar with staples or by screwing a second spar over it. Push the fabric in between the top and second down spar so it forms a pocket about 15-20cm deep. Place a few staples in the second down spar so the fabric doesn’t slip. This will not need to be as secure as on the top spar as the weight of the compost will hold each pocket in place. Repeat the process down to the bottom of the wall and securely attach the end of the fabric to the bottom spar.
How to attach the landscape fabric to create the pockets.
5) FILLING- We decided not to add any ingredients to the compost like pumice or perlite to reduce the weight as we were happy that the structure would support the weight. We mixed plenty of slow release fertiliser granules into the mix as there will be a large amount of plants in a relatively small volume of compost. We also added a quantity of swell gel to aid water retention. Fill the wall from the bottom pocket up so that each filled pocket rests on the one previous. Fold up the excess landscape fabric that was folded in on either side to prevent the compost from spilling out the end of the pockets. Each pocket should only be filled three quarters as the root balls from the plants will take up a proportion of the space and the soil level in the pocket must be just below the spar so water can soak in and not poor off the wall.
The newly planted wall before the leaves have turned up to the light.
6) PLANTING- We set the plants out on the floor in front of the wall to create a design before we started to plant. Spacing will depend on the plants you use and the size of the plant used. Start planting from the top down. If you plant from the bottom up the lower plants will be covered with compost. Lay a sheet down bellow the wall as a lot of compost will be spilt. Make shore the plants are well watered before planting as many of the root balls will have to be teased apart and squeezed into pockets. Despite our planning we changed the design considerably while planting as it looked so different when vertical. Liz more so than other gardeners is a very impatient gardener so we planted a little closer than was probably necessary and plugged the gaps with Tradescantia cuttings, Spider plants and Begonia sutherlandii. These quickly grew and filled the gaps. We debated weather to use only evergreens but decided this would be too limiting on the design possibilities and would make the wall predominantly green. The down side to using deciduous or herbaceous plants was that the wall will look a little sparse over winter. We put a few dwarf Daffodils in the wall to see how they would fair. These wouldn’t hide the landscape fabric, but would add a splash of colour before the new shoots emerge.
7) WATERING- The wall will have to be completely manually watered. Rain will have little if any benefit to the wall other than slowing the rate at which the wall dries out, plus the leaves will arrange themselves like roof tiles shedding all the rain water. We didn’t get around to installing a trickle irrigation system and hand water the wall daily, sometimes twice if it is really hot and or windy. From autumn to early spring watering will be much less but still important. To install a trickle system there would need to be one trickle pipe along each pocket with dripper every 30cm or so. The dripper pipe would need to be the sort that delivers a specific flow of water rather than a simple leaky pipe as the bottom of the wall would receive more water than the top. The watering regime would have to be little and often to prevent the nutrients from being leached from the compost.
8) FEEDING- The slow release fertiliser we put in the wall was more than enough to see the plants through the first season with no signs of stress. The second and subsequent years are where attention is needed. Each perennial plant should have a hanging basket pellet pushed into the compost near the root ball. Any annual or replanted patches should have the old compost removed and replaced with fresh compost and slow release fertiliser. The old compost will be matted with the roots of perennial plants which should be carefully cut without cutting the landscape fabric. If a trickle system is installed a liquid drip feeder could be attached or if hand watered use an occasional folia feed.
